Using AI in Business Operations

AI isn’t just for tech giants. It’s making waves in all sorts of businesses. Here’s where folks are putting AI to work:

Business Function Percentage of Businesses Using AI
Customer Service 56%
Cybersecurity and Fraud Management 51%
Customer Relationship Management 46%
Digital Personal Assistants 47%
Inventory Management 40%
Content Production 35%

Many businesses are also using AI-powered chatbots for instant messaging (73%) and optimizing emails (61%) to keep the conversation flowing with customers (Forbes). These tools can help you offer personalized services, like product recommendations (55%) and targeted ads (46%).

AI’s perks don’t stop there. It can also boost production, automate tasks (51%), improve SEO, gather data, and cut safety risks. Using AI in these areas can make your business run smoother and help you make smarter decisions.

Benefits and Concerns of AI in Business

AI has its ups and downs. Here’s a quick look at the good and the not-so-good:

Benefits

  • Better Customer Relationships: 64% of business owners think AI will make customer interactions better and boost productivity.
  • Sales Growth: 60% believe AI will help increase sales.
  • Cost Savings: 59% expect to save money thanks to AI efficiencies.
  • Streamlined Processes: 42% see AI as a way to make job processes smoother and cut response times (53%).

Concerns

  • Job Loss: AI can make employees worry about losing their jobs.
  • Data Privacy: Using AI might raise issues about data security.
  • Tech Dependence: Relying too much on AI could reduce human oversight in important decisions.
